i didn´t read the whole ¨baseball players are best athletes thread¨ or a lot of the other sports threads so this may have been touched on but I was wondering, if you wanted to find out what sport had the best athletes, wouldn´t the best question be, ¨if all sports stopped paying athletes altogether except for, say, hockey how many current hockey players would be replaced?¨ and then just ask the same for all of the other sports. presumably, the sport with the smallest turn over would contain the best athletes. or maybe not, but i think that would be my first experiment in trying to answer the question, if such an experiment were possible. you can just answer yes or no about the supremacy of that question for determining what sport has the best athletes.
